n alpha particle (q = +2e, m = 4.00 u) travels in a circular path of radius 5.94 cm in a uniform magnetic field with B = 1.10 T.
9966 [12]

Answer:

a). V = 3.13*10⁶ m/s

b). T = 1.19*10^-7s

c). K.E = 2.04*10⁵

d). V = 1.02*10⁵V

Explanation:

q = +2e

M = 4.0u

r = 5.94cm = 0.0594m

B = 1.10T

1u = 1.67 * 10^-27kg

M = 4.0 * 1.67*10^-27 = 6.68*10^-27kg

a). Centripetal force = magnetic force

Mv / r = qB

V = qBr / m

V = [(2 * 1.60*10^-19) * 1.10 * 0.0594] / 6.68*10^-27

V = 2.09088 * 10^-20 / 6.68 * 10^-27

V = 3.13*10⁶ m/s

b). Period of revolution.

T = 2Πr / v

T = (2*π*0.0594) / 3.13*10⁶

T = 1.19*10⁻⁷s

c). kinetic energy = ½mv²

K.E = ½ * 6.68*10^-27 * (3.13*10⁶)²

K.E = 3.27*10^-14J

1ev = 1.60*10^-19J

xeV = 3.27*10^-14J

X = 2.04*10⁵eV

K.E = 2.04*10⁵eV

d). K.E = qV

V = K / q

V = 2.04*10⁵ / (2eV).....2e-

V = 1.02*10⁵V
